3 Regional Photographers Join The Renowned Canon EMEA 2020 Ambassador Programme

Saudi’s Tasneem Alsultan is one of those linking up with some of the world’s top photographers and videographers from across Europe, the Middle East and Africa…

With the region teeming with artistic talent, it isn’t surprising to see more and more success stories coming to light. One of the latest is Canon in Europe, Middle East and Africa (EMEA) recognising three leading regional photographers for their 2020 Ambassador Programme. After crushing the most competitive selection process yet, Tasneem Alsultan, Muhammed Muheisen and Jorge Ferrari have joined 56 other new professionals as Canon EMEA expands the world-renowned pioneering initiative.

Saudi-American Alsultan is an investigative photographer, storyteller and global traveller who offers an intimate and unique perspective into the everyday lives of her subjects. And hailing from Jordan, Muheisen is a two-time Pulitzer Prize winner, who has documented major global events. For the past decade, the shutterbug has been following the refugee crisis around the world. UAE-based Ferrari, meanwhile, is an action and commercial photographer, who is known for his striking images and captivating visual storytelling.

The three uber-talented creatives won over an esteemed panel of 13 judges who reviewed nominations for over 450 photographers. The judges evaluated over 20,000 photos covering news, documentary, wildlife, weddings, portraits, sports and more.

“The Middle East is home to a rich pool of talent and we are proud to offer a platform that showcases the creativity of the region. We are continually looking for talented photographers and videographers to cultivate their talent and help take the art of visual storytelling to new heights,” Binoj Nair, B2C Marketing Director at Canon Middle East, said. “With the addition of three new ambassadors within the 2020 programme, we will be able to showcase the diversity, depth and richness of the Middle East, with even more fortitude and conviction.”

With the largest ever intake, now featuring a total of 115 Ambassadors across EMEA, this is Canon’s most exciting and diverse programme to date. Seventeen incredible young photographers, including Ksenia Kuleshova and Michele Spatari, alumni of the Canon Student Programme and Young Photographer Award winners, are among those who are being enabled, empowered and supported with the tools to tell stories that matter. 

About the Canon EMEA Ambassador Programme 
A celebration of visual storytelling and stories that resonate, the first of its kind Canon EMEA Ambassador Programme was originally launched in 2008. It was created to represent and support current and future generations of photographers and filmmakers. The best of the best within the imaging industry share their passion and technical know-how with fellow professionals, as well as enthusiastic amateurs who want to develop their skills.
